  • Patent number: 9447371
    Abstract: A holding structure for holding a plurality of culture plates in a stacked arrangement includes a feature for de-nesting the bottom culture plate from the plate above it. The de-nesting feature is preferably a structure which urges a plate to move laterally relative to the plate above it. The de-nesting of the bottom culture plate from the adjacent culture plate facilitates withdrawal of the bottom culture plate from the base via a robotic plate transfer mechanism. The de-nesting feature can be entirely passive, such as ramps formed in the base of the holding structure.

  • Patent number: 9162326
    Abstract: An incubator is fitted with an enclosure which surrounds the incubator. A cold air generation system supplies relatively cold air to a space formed between enclosure and the incubator. The system supplying the cold air can be embodied in a cart or base upon which the incubator sits. The enclosure is also placed on the base in a manner such that it substantially envelops the incubator. The top of the cart has openings for egress of cold air and return of air so that air may circulate in a closed loop. The incubator, cold air supply system and enclosure present a solution for incubating samples in a nominal 20-25° C. temperature environment. The enclosure, which is preferably insulated, may include a void or opening which exposes doors or other access device of the incubator, allowing direct access to the samples in the incubator while the rest of the incubator is enveloped by the enclosure.
